Will Day Avoids Further Surgery as Season Ends After Navicular Setback

Hawthorn anticipates Day will be fully fit by next pre-season after scans revealed no new fracture in his repaired foot

Overview

  • Latest scans showed no new fracture in Day’s operated navicular bone, clearing him of additional surgery.
  • Bone inflammation and a hotspot further down his right foot have officially ended his AFL season after six appearances.
  • Coach Sam Mitchell expressed full confidence that Day will return to consistent AFL fitness by the start of next pre-season.
  • Cam Mackenzie is poised to replace Day in Hawthorn’s midfield following strong performances for Box Hill.
  • Navicular injuries have previously sidelined AFL stars and highlight the need for cautious rehabilitation.
